D-2.2. Population Impact

HHSC pharmacists will estimate the potential use of the drug by people enrolled in Medicaid by reviewing the following:

  • NDC package inserts and indications
  • Compendia and epidemiology clinical studies
  • Texas Medicaid claim and encounter utilization (in situations when a manufacturer replaces one NDC with another)
  • CMS website (medicaid.gov/medicaid/prescription-drugs/medicaid-drug-rebate-program/) to identify if other states have reported drug utilization data for the NDC). The data includes state, drug name, NDC, number of prescriptions, and dollars reimbursed if available.
  • Other sources, such as specialty pharmacies, manufacturers, and various foundations

The pharmacist will determine if the drug requires clinical prior authorization and, if needed, develops the criteria.  Using clinical judgment and the information gathered above, the pharmacist will then estimate the number of people enrolled in fee-for-service and managed care who meet the coverage requirements.
